Latest Patents

Among his latest patents is the "True Electric Vehicle Charging Price Evaluation and Optimization." This invention allows a vehicle to determine its current state of charge and battery temperature. Based on these parameters, the vehicle calculates a charge acceptance rate and identifies charging stations that meet predefined charging criteria. This innovation aims to optimize the charging process for electric vehicles, ensuring that users can find suitable charging options efficiently.

Another notable patent is the "Electrified Vehicle with Wound Rotor Synchronous Electric Machine Controlled to Heat Battery." This technology features a wound rotor synchronous electric machine that provides propulsive torque to the vehicle's wheels. It includes a cooling system that circulates fluid to transfer heat from the electric machine to the battery, enhancing the vehicle's performance and battery life. The controller in this system is programmed to manage the machine's operation to generate heat, benefiting the battery and other components.
